The Ultimate Guide to Offline Affiliate Marketing with QR Codes

When we think of affiliate marketing, we often picture a YouTuber posting a link in their description, a blogger embedding a hyperlink in a review, or an Instagrammer sharing a “Link in Bio.” But by limiting your affiliate program to the internet, you overlook offline channels.

Despite e-commerce, a massive amount of product discovery still happens offline. People trust their gym trainers, their hairstylists, and the professionals they interact with face-to-face far more than they trust a stranger on the internet.

The digital advertising space is crowded, and ad blindness is real. However, the offline promotions offer lower competition with higher trust signals.

The Trust Factor

Consider this scenario: You see an ad on Instagram for a new shampoo. You scroll past it. Now, consider this: You are sitting in a salon chair. Your stylist, who has been cutting your hair for five years, finishes up and says, “Your hair is a bit dry. I’ve been using this new argan oil brand on all my clients, and it’s a game-changer. I don’t stock it here, but you can order it online.”

That recommendation is gold. It has a near-100% trust rating.

  • The Problem: If the client goes home and Googles the brand, the stylist gets no credit, and you (the merchant) lose the data on where that customer came from.
  • The Solution: The stylist hands the client a card with a QR code. The client scans it and buys the oil on their phone while still in the chair. The stylist gets a commission. You get a sale.
Use Cases: Perfect for Physical Goods & Local Partners

Before getting into the “how-to,” let’s consider the “who.” The best candidates for offline affiliate marketing are brands with physical products and local touchpoints, as traditional links may not be effective for them.

1. Gym Owners Promoting Supplements

Gym trainers recommend protein, pre‑workouts, or recovery gear to members. They hand out flyers or cards at check‑in: “Scan for 15% off my favorite supplement > QR”.

2. Hairdressers & Salons Promoting Shampoo/Conditioner

Stylists recommend specific products post‑cut: “This shampoo keeps your color vibrant, here, scan my code for 20% off (QR on card)”. Salons become micro‑distribution points, earning on every bottle sold.

3. Pop‑up Shops, Markets, Trade Shows

Vendors at farmers markets, craft fairs, or expos scan QR codes on booth signage or bags: “Loved our jam? 10% off next jar with code MARKET10 [QR]”. Events convert impulse buyers into tracked customers.

Why it works: Physical interactions build trust faster than digital ads. QR scans convert at a higher rate than digital ads, especially with local relevance.

The Tool: How GoAffPro Powers the “Scan-to-Sale” flow

GoAffPro provides affiliates the option to get a QR code that seamlessly directs customers to their referral link, leading directly to the store.

How Affiliates Generate QR Codes
  1. Log in to the brand’s affiliate portal.
  2. In the Home tab (below the referral link) > Click on the QR code.
  3. Download the QR code.
  4. You can now share it. Print on flyers, cards, posters, etc.
How Affiliates Generate QR Codes

GoAffPro allows affiliates to generate QR codes for specific product pages, not just your homepage.

  1. Go to the Marketing Tools > Product Links section.
  2. Select a product or paste that product’s link in the product link generator.
  3. A trackable product link will be generated automatically with a QR code that directs to it.
QR codes for specific product pages

How does it works for the customers?

  • When a customer scans the code with their phone camera, it opens your store in their mobile browser. Instantly, GoAffPro drops a referral cookie to tag the visitor.
  • Even if the customer doesn’t buy immediately, say, they scan it at the gym but buy it later that night, the attribution will remain intact (depending on your cookie duration).
Useful Strategies:
The “Affiliate Business Card”

This is the highest-converting offline tool. Create a template for a business card that your affiliates can print (or you can print for them as a reward).

  • Front: Your Brand Logo + The Affiliate’s Name/Brand.
  • Back: A large, clear QR Code.
  • The Hook: Text that says “Scan for discount% Off.”
  • Why it works: A physical card has weight. People put it in their wallets. It serves as a physical reminder to buy later.
Packaging Inserts (The “Unboxing” Loop)

This is a strategy for your existing customers to become affiliates.

  • Include a flyer in your shipping boxes: “Want to earn cash? Sign up for our affiliate program!
  • Include a QR code that takes them directly to the GoAffPro signup page.
  • The Twist: Give them a set of “Friend Referral Cards” in the box. “Give these 3 cards to friends. If they scan and buy, you get $20.

FAQ
How does GoAffPro track offline QR code scans?

QR codes embed the affiliate’s unique referral link. Scans land on the store page, and purchases are attributed via link or coupon.​

What’s the best use case for offline tracking?

Local partners like gym owners (supplements), hairdressers (haircare), and pop‑ups (craft goods). QR on flyers/cards converts impulse buyers.

Where do affiliates generate their QR codes?

Affiliates can get their QR code from their dashboard (below their referral link) or generate product-specific QR codes from the Marketing Tools > Product Links section.​

What if the customer scans the code but doesn’t buy immediately?

This is handled by your “Cookie Duration” settings in GoAffPro. If you set your cookie duration to 30 days, the customer can scan the flyer at the gym on Tuesday > buy on Friday, and the affiliate will still get paid.

Do QR codes expire?

No. The QR codes generated by GoAffPro are static representations of the affiliate’s link. As long as your website is active and the affiliate is in your program, the code will work forever.
